What does natural resource mean?

natural resource meaning in General Dictionary

resources (real and prospective) given by nature

natural resource meaning in Law Dictionary

et or product leading to the country's all-natural capital. To draw out, process, or improve natural sources requires money and recruiting, as psychological and actual labor. By these means, the world obtains its true economic value.

natural resource meaning in Business Dictionary

resource or material that constitutes the natural capital of a nation. Normal resources require application of money and hr (psychological and actual labor) becoming exploited (extracted, prepared, refined) when it comes to realization of these economic worth.

Sentence Examples with the word natural resource

We are blooming, not withering, as we leverage the greatest natural resource on the planet: the human mind.

View more Sentence Examples